About the role

Assesses the provisioning of hosting solutions for AIT's stakeholders at FAA's data centers, Co-location facilities, and FAA Cloud Service (FCS) providers. The Hosting Management Branch works closely with the Operations and Maintenance Branch, which executes the provisioning of hosting solutions for AIT's stakeholders at FAA's data centers, Colocation facilities, and FAA Cloud Service (FCS) providers. Supports hosting file share resources for FAA field facilities. Responsible for securing and managing AIT's operating systems, servers, virtual infrastructure, storage and backup solutions, and the F5 environment for load balancing application servers. Provides environmental (space, power, cooling) hosting within the data centers, provisions the infrastructure to support web hosting, and configures the operating system environment for system disaster recovery solutions, both on premises and in FCS. In addition, you will be responsible for the following: Serving as a first level supervisor
